Fall Football: A Major Part of Student Life During the fall season, many students attended the football games and were in- volved in various activities. Some sold re- freshments which earned them extra money. Some students gave their time to learn medical self help. They were always there during football games in case of in- juries. The band played a big part in sup- porting the lezlm. providing music. enter- tainment during halftime, and help in pepping up the cheers. Along with the band were the members of the pep club. They made signs for the football players to run through. decorations for the stands and helped with the cheers. L... The Spirit of the Great Pumpkin lnvades Hinkley October 31, 1979, was Halloween at Hinkley High. The festivities began with the students dressing up in their favorite outfits. There were not only the usual ghosts and goblins but bunnies, Hot Lips, Jr.. a Knight in shining armor and the most original, a drunk old man. It was full of fun and enjoyment for all with a lot of participation on the part of students and faculty alike.
